Original Description
Velodrome A Paris by Irena Hassenberg is a captivating depiction of Parisian dynamism from the early 20th century. The painting exudes an exhilarating sense of movement through its swirling brushstrokes and vibrant palette, perfectly capturing the energy of bicycle races in a Belle Époque velodrome. Created in the 1900-1910 period when Hassenberg was active in Paris's avant-garde circles, it exemplifies the Post-Impressionist Fauvist transitional style - with its bold color choices and liberated forms anticipating Expressionism while maintaining Impressionist light sensitivity. Historically significant, it bridges the gap between academic Salon painting and modern abstraction, reflecting how avant-garde women artists like Hassenberg reinterpreted urban leisure scenes. The work's chromatic intensity and gestural quality make it an important predecessor to later movements like Die Brücke, though it remained less known than male contemporaries until feminist art historical reappraisals.
